Denmark: 1,427 new COVID-19 infections, 5 fatalities reported

On Friday, Denmark reported 1,427 new COVID-19 infections and five additional fatalities, all of which occurred over the past 24 hours.

In total, Denmark has reported 53,180 COVID-19 cases and 738 coronavirus related fatalities.

The United States is currently leading global COVID-19 cases with over 9.9 million infections and 241,291 fatalities, although India follows closely behind with 8.4 million cases and 125,528 deaths. As for the third-highest case toll and death toll, Brazil follows with 5.6 million cases and 161,871 deaths, Russia with 1.7 million cases and 29,887 deaths, and France with 1.6 million cases and 39,037 coronavirus related deaths.

The novel coronavirus was first discovered in Wuhan, Hubei, China, on Dec. 31, 2019, and has infected more than 49 million individuals worldwide, resulting in over 1.3 million fatalities across 216 countries and territories.
